Kimberly May is a Senior Accredited Practising Dietitian and co-founder of Happier, Healthier – Nutrition & Dietetics. Originally from Kangaroo Island, Kimberly has called Gladstone home since 2019, where she has become a trusted and familiar face within the community.
Known for her warm, practical and client-centred approach, Kimberly specialises in complex clinical nutrition, NDIS support, eating disorders, enteral nutrition and paediatric feeding. As a certified SOS Feeding Therapist, she provides specialised therapy for fussy eating, ARFID and sensory-based feeding challenges.
Kimberly is passionate about creating an approachable, inclusive service that supports people of all ages and abilities. She also plays a key leadership role within Happier, Healthier — supervising clinicians, providing ongoing training, and offering mentorship to support team development and high-quality clinical practice across all locations.
Dedicated to professional development and community wellbeing, Kimberly continues to drive innovation, service improvement and strong health partnerships throughout Central Queensland.
Brie James is a Senior Accredited Practising Dietitian and co-founder of Happier, Healthier – Nutrition & Dietetics. Growing up in Brisbane, Brie moved to Gladstone in 2020 and has since become a highly respected clinician known for her compassionate, down-to-earth communication style.
Brie has extensive experience in complex clinical nutrition, NDIS support, eating disorders, enteral nutrition and paediatric feeding. She is dedicated to providing practical, sustainable nutrition strategies that empower clients to feel confident and supported in their health journey.
Brie is deeply committed to the growth and development of the Happier, Healthier team. She provides clinical supervision, mentoring and training to clinicians, ensuring high-quality, evidence-based care and a supportive environment for new and developing dietitians. Her leadership contributes significantly to service innovation, program development and clinical quality across the region.
Outside the clinic, Brie volunteers as the Vice President of the Gladstone Chamber of Commerce & Industry, contributing her expertise and passion to support the local business community and regional development.
Grace Hatton is an Accredited Practising Dietitian who joined the Happier, Healthier team in January 2025. Growing up on a cattle property, Grace brings a strong connection to rural communities and a genuine passion for improving access to quality healthcare across regional areas. She later completed her studies on the Sunshine Coast, where her love for health, sport and running further shaped her approach to nutrition and wellbeing.
As a skilled generalist clinician, Grace supports clients across a wide range of areas including chronic disease management, bariatric surgery nutrition, paediatric nutrition, gastrointestinal conditions and NDIS support. She is known for her warm, down-to-earth communication style and her ability to simplify nutrition into realistic, sustainable steps that suit each person’s lifestyle.
Grace plays a vital role in delivering Happier, Healthier’s outreach services, providing regular clinics in Biloela, Monto and Theodore, along with comprehensive online consultations for clients throughout Central Queensland. Her dedication, enthusiasm and evidence-based practice make her an invaluable part of the team and a trusted clinician for clients and families across the region.

Laura Panochini is an Accredited Practising Dietitian and Paediatric Specialist who joined the Happier, Healthier team in mid-2025. Growing up in Brisbane, Laura has always had a passion for working with children and families, bringing warmth, patience and creativity to her practice.
Laura specialises in paediatric nutrition, including growth concerns, feeding difficulties, fussy eating, ARFID, sensory-based feeding challenges and gastrointestinal conditions. As a qualified SOS Feeding Therapist, she provides evidence-based, play-focused feeding therapy that supports children to feel safe, confident and curious around food.
Known for her gentle communication style and her ability to connect with children and parents alike, Laura uses practical, family-friendly strategies that make mealtimes more enjoyable and less stressful. She is committed to helping families build strong feeding foundations that support long-term wellbeing, development and positive relationships with food.
Outside of work, Laura enjoys baking for friends and family, often using it as a way to bring people together—something that reflects her belief in food as connection, comfort and celebration. Her warm approach and specialised expertise make her an invaluable part of the paediatric team at Happier, Healthier.
